Compare all specifications:
1996 Bristol Blenheim | 1990 Volkswagen Golf | |
Make | Bristol | Volkswagen |
Model | Blenheim | Golf |
Year Released | 1996 | 1990 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 5898 cc | 1781 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 8 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| V | in-line |
Horse Power | 228 HP | 161 HP |
Engine RPM | 4000 RPM | 5600 RPM |
Torque | 441 Nm | 225 Nm |
Torque RPM | 3200 RPM | 4000 RPM |
Drive Type | Rear | Front |
Transmission Type | Automatic | Manual |
Vehicle Weight | 1745 kg | 1077 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4880 mm | 3990 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1760 mm | 1690 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1450 mm | 1410 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2910 mm | 2480 mm |
